Queer Paranormal (an exhibition concerning Shirley Jackson and “The Haunting of Hill House”)

Queer Paranormal
VAPA Usdan Gallery

OPEN TO THE PUBLIC | Queer Paranormal (an exhibition concerning Shirley Jackson and “The Haunting of Hill House”) presents a range of artistic practices “haunted” by historical, political and sexual difference.

Sara Emsaki

VALS—Fall 2019
Tishman Lecture Hall

OPEN TO PUBLIC | Sara Emsaki (b. 1989) is a painter and printmaker who lives and works between the United States and Iran. Her work “interrogates the multiple roles and codes individuals embody at the intersection of contrasting religious, cultural and aesthetic traditions.”

Music Festival 2019

three Black and white photos of musicians on stage
Deane Carriage Barn

OPEN TO THE PUBLIC | The Bennington College annual Music Festival is an eclectic program of student compositions and performances across the spectrum—string quartets, rock bands, choruses, and electronics—plus other surprises. Free and open to the public.
